How Can Severe Pain In The Lower Back Be Treated?

Unbearable lower back pain. I have compression fracture in L12. Was diagnosed on Monday with an x-ray. The pain is getting much worse. Lying on ice packs. Have meds for pain, are not working at all. Any suggestions appreciated. Thank You Barbara Horton YYYY

Orthopaedic Surgeon 's  Response
dear patient
treatment for l12 compression fracture is strict bed rest for one month. Rest should be on hard bed. Analgesics like tab diclofenac sodium 50 mg twice a day with tab ultracet twice a day should be taken. In bed physiotherapy and log rolling 2 hourly is advised to prevent bed sore. if pain is still not relieved consultation with spine surgeon is recommended. Vertebroplasty is good option for immediate pain relief.
